<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>259515</bug_id>
          
          <creation_ts>2023-07-25 18:04:17 -0700</creation_ts>
          <short_desc>[GLib] TestWebsiteData/hsts test needs new base data directories for new API</short_desc>
          <delta_ts>2023-07-26 13:08:22 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>New Bugs</component>
          <version>WebKit Local Build</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Amanda Falke">abstractmachines</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>webkit-bug-importer</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1968181</commentid>
    <comment_count>0</comment_count>
    <who name="Amanda Falke">abstractmachines</who>
    <bug_when>2023-07-25 18:04:17 -0700</bug_when>
    <thetext>As mentioned in 260511@main and 261018@main, A GLib-specific bug in the
defaultHSTSStorageDirectory is fixed, but only for the new API versions.

The HSTS database goes under the base cache directory if provided, but
if not provided it goes under the base data directory; leave it broken in
the original API versions to avoid leaking the HSTS database on disk.
Also, move it to a subdirectory in the new API version.

We need to update these directories for TestWebsiteData/hsts API tests.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1968290</commentid>
    <comment_count>1</comment_count>
    <who name="EWS">ews-feeder</who>
    <bug_when>2023-07-26 13:07:36 -0700</bug_when>
    <thetext>Committed 266326@main (c646f2370d23): &lt;https://commits.webkit.org/266326@main&gt;

Reviewed commits have been landed. Closing PR #16093 and removing active labels.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1968291</commentid>
    <comment_count>2</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2023-07-26 13:08:22 -0700</bug_when>
    <thetext>&lt;rdar://problem/112929346&gt;</thetext>
  </long_desc>
      
      

    </bug>

</bugzilla>